Inspection history
4 visits, newest first
Met inspection standards. 1 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.
Commercially processed 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food opened and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ked after opening. Observed opened container of milk opened 3 days prior with no date marking.
Met inspection standards. 4 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

Live, small flying insects found. Observed 3 small flying insects under soda gun holster next to ice bin.
Food-contact surface soiled with food debris, mold-like substance or slime. Observed; standing water in ice scoop holster next to ice bin. Soda gun holster at end of bar soiled with debris build up.
Handwash sink used for purposes other than handwashing. Observed multiple metal pan tops stored in hand wash sink next to three compartment sink. Person in charge removed pan tops.
Operator is not properly tracking/marking the number of days opened commercially processed, 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food was held at refrigeration temperatures prior to freezing in order to properly date mark the food when it is thawed and held at refrigeration temperatures again. Observed commercially processed shredded cheese and pre-cooked beef stored in flip top cooler with a date marking when it was opened and frozen. No date marking when it was removed from freezer.
A return visit. The problems from the previous inspection had been dealt with.
Violations found and a warning issued, with a return visit required. 7 recorded.

Food-contact surface soiled with food debris, mold-like substance or slime. White cutting board in front of flip top cooler.
No certified food manager for establishment. A list of accredited food manager certification examination providers can be found at http://www.myfloridalicense.com/DBPR/hotels-restaurants/food-lodging/food-manager/ Only certification presented expired in 2023. No other food manager certification present.
Required employee training expired for all employees. To order approved program food safety material, call DBPR contracted provider: Florida Restaurant and Lodging Association (SafeStaff) 866-372-7233. All employee training records are expired.
Clean wiping cloth supply not properly stored. Red sanitizer bucket on back bar with packaged chips. Bucket moved and stored correctly.
Current Hotel and Restaurant license not displayed. License displayed expired 06/01/2022.
Floor tiles missing and/or in disrepair. In bar by triple sink.
Open dumpster lid. Shared blue dumpster behind establishment. Lid closed.
